Hello all,I'd like to add that the latest development version, 4.2.20100527.2031, introduces another undocumented dependency: Berkely DB, Java Edition. I'm not exactly sure what NJ uses it for, but NcML aggregation fails without it.
For Maven projects that use the latest unbundled NJ, add the following elements to your pom.xml:
<repositories> <!-- For com.sleepycat.je --> <repository> <id>download.oracle.com/maven</id> <url>http://download.oracle.com/maven</url> </repository> </repositories> ... </dependencies> <dependency> <groupId>com.sleepycat</groupId> <artifactId>je</artifactId> <version>4.0.71</version> </dependency> </dependencies> Regards, Christian Ward-Garrison On 6/10/2010 1:29 AM, Nils Hoffmann wrote:
Hi John, hi list! I'm using the unbundled version of netcdf-java 4.1 to read files in netcdf format (ANDI-MS, ANDI-CHROM). However, I found that the jar dependencies noted on this page http://www.unidata.ucar.edu/software/netcdf-java/reference/JarDependencies.html are not really up to date. I had to add unidatacommon.jar to my classpath to avoid the following exception: java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: ucar/unidata/geoloc/ProjectionImpl at ucar.nc2.iosp.nids.Nidsiosp.isValidFile(Nidsiosp.java:81) at ucar.nc2.NetcdfFile.open(NetcdfFile.java:742) at ucar.nc2.NetcdfFile.open(NetcdfFile.java:403) at ucar.nc2.NetcdfFile.open(NetcdfFile.java:373) at ucar.nc2.NetcdfFile.open(NetcdfFile.java:360) at ucar.nc2.NetcdfFile.open(NetcdfFile.java:348) ... (my call stack skipped) ... Caused by: java.lang.ClassNotFoundException: ucar.unidata.geoloc.ProjectionImpl at java.net.URLClassLoader$1.run(URLClassLoader.java:202) at java.security.AccessController.doPrivileged(Native Method) at java.net.URLClassLoader.findClass(URLClassLoader.java:190) at java.lang.ClassLoader.loadClass(ClassLoader.java:307) at sun.misc.Launcher$AppClassLoader.loadClass(Launcher.java:301) at java.lang.ClassLoader.loadClass(ClassLoader.java:248) ... 15 more As far as I understand it, ProjectionImpl should only be required by a NetcdfDataset implementation?
